Sounds like the hammer leaf spring isent contacting the hammer disconnect, if you take it apart the middle prong of the leaf spring should rest on the hammer disconnect, if its not touching it at all or just barely that’s probably the issue, i had something similar happen to me when i was swapping out the grip for my tm hi capa the leaf spring sat lower in the new grip than it did with the stock one and it would lock the hammer back once when fired then go full auto.
